Is anyone using both? I'm installing radiant floor heat and will be using a propane water heater for that. I am thinking of keeping that set low all winter to keep it above freezing (maybe 40 or so???) and have an ceiling mounted Big Maxx or similar to heat the garage up quickly when I need to use it.
Good idea or bad? Any thoughts welcome.
Specs:
Garage is 2.5 car, 28X26 with a gable roof that goes about 15' in the highest peak. (only 1 bay will go that high, other side has a loft that will be closed in so only about 7' high in that bay. Fully insulated with R13 in the 2X4 stud walls and R-19 in the 2X8 roof rafters and drywalled.
